Job Summary
Plans and conducts activities concerned with the quality control and quality assurance of industrial processes, materials and products.
Responsibilities / Accountability & Authority
- Designs and installs quality control process sampling systems, procedures, and statistical techniques.
- Designs or specifies inspection and testing mechanisms and equipment.
- Analyzes production limitations and standards.
- Recommends revision of specifications when indicated.
- Formulates or assists in formulating quality control policies and procedures.
- Develops the economics of any quality control program when required.
- Devises sampling procedures and designs and develops forms and instructions for recording, evaluating, and reporting quality and reliability data.
- Establishes program to evaluate precision and accuracy of production equipment and testing, measurement and facilities.
- Performs quality engineering reviews of design documentation for compliance with stated requirements, including vendor quality manuals and company quality records.
- Applies statistical process control (SPC) methods for analyzing data to evaluate the current process and process changes.
- Reviews all purchased products or components and provides input to the decision to accept the product and future purchases from the vendor.
- Prepares relevant reports, forms and verifies the results of quality activities.
- Prepares and presents technical and program information to team members and management.
- Directs technical and administrative workers engaged in quality activities.
- Maintains a working knowledge of government and industry quality codes and standards.
- Responsible for the entire quality of production at all operations and projects in coating.
- Maintain Company QA programs and QMS, conducts ISO 9001-2015 internal and external audits.
- Root cause analysis, preventive and reactive action analysis.
- Provides quality training to all the employees.
- Supervise the entire quality team comprising lead inspectors, QA / QC inspectors and Lab Inspectors.
- Responsible for plant qualification, product qualification and quarterly sample corporate quality approval.
- Handling quality documents like ITP, QAR, NCR, MOC, PCP, COC and IC.
- Perform other work-related tasks as assigned.
- Comply with all NOV Company and HSE procedures and policies.
